Patrick Mahomes

Patrick Mahomes Rushing TD
Player Prop Week 14

Denver Broncos vs Kansas City Chiefs

 
 
 
Patrick Mahomes Rushing TD Prop is currently Over/Under 0.5 (+386/-804).

The money has been on the Over as it opened 0.5 @ +389 before it was bet up to 0.5 @ +386.
FACTORS THAT FAVOR THE OVER:
  • The Chiefs are a huge 8.5-point favorite in this game, indicating an extreme rushing game script.
  • THE BLITZ projects the Chiefs to run the 6th-most plays on offense on the slate this week with 67.4 plays, based on their underlying tendencies and game dynamics.
  • The Kansas City Chiefs have called the 10th-most plays in the league this year, averaging a colossal 59.8 plays per game.
  • THE BLITZ projects Patrick Mahomes to be a much bigger part of his offense's rushing attack near the end zone this week (9.5% projected Red Zone Carry Share) than he has been this year (3.5% in games he has played).
  • The Kansas City Chiefs offensive line profiles as the 4th-best in football this year at blocking for the run game.

  • FACTORS THAT FAVOR THE UNDER:
  • THE BLITZ projects the Kansas City Chiefs as the 3rd-least run-centric team in the league near the goal line (in a neutral context) at the present time with a 35.4% red zone run rate.
  • Opposing teams have rushed for the 6th-least touchdowns in the league (0.58 per game) vs. the Denver Broncos defense this year.
  • The Kansas City Chiefs have gone no-huddle on just 1.8% of their play-calls outside the two-minute warning since the start of last season (least in the league). This deadens the pace, resulting in less volume and stat production.
  • The Kansas City Chiefs have elected to go for it on 4th down just 15.8% of the time since the start of last season (9th-least in football), which typically means less offensive volume, less TD potential, and lower offensive statistics across the board.
